ian^:

- southsoniks / aka soulshift - labels like scandium & adrenogroov (check out other releases by other artists as well)
tune to check out:southsoniks - litentia electronica on 'scandium 018'

- the youngsters - mainly released on f-com, but also check out other releases here as well by other artists
tune to checkout: the youngsters - place, race & face on 'f-com 194lp'

- tomie nevada - labels like zenit, memory lane & elp medien
tune to check out: tomie nevada - take control on 'elp medien 22002'

- vince watson - labels like alola, bio + remixes on other various labels
tune to check out: vince watson - parallels on 'bio 13'

- dan corco & fred carreira - labels like rotation + other artists that have released there, 7th gate and dave angel for example.
tune to check out: dan corco & fred carreira - past & present on 'fono 002'

- jel ford - labels like jericho, rotation, platform
tune to check out: jel ford - medusa on 'rotation 02036'

- scan x - labels like f-com
tune to checl out: scan x - higher on 'f-com 176'

- tehnasia - labels like technasia, sino hong kong, music man
tune to check out: technasia - final quadrant on 'technasia 07'

- 7th gate - labels like rotation
tune to check out: 7th gate - route 4 on 'rotation 98016'


and finally

artists on the kanzleramt label might be a bit harder or more melodic, but all in all - among the best labels that are around.

the artists here mainly releases on this label, but they also got a few gems on other labels as well.

- alexander kowalski / aka double x (w/ torsten litschko)
tunes to check out: alexander kowalski - speaker attack on 'kanzleramt 76' & double x - lydkraft on 'kanzleramt 113'

- diego
tune to check out: diego - quarter inch squares (club mix) on 'kanzleramt 104'

- heiko laux
tune to check out: heiko laux - omaments (synthesized) on 'kanzleramt 75'

- fabrice lig
tune to check out: fabrice lig - black stone on 'kanzleramt 89'

- johannes heil
tune to check out: johannes heil - forever on 'kanzleramt 100'


plenty of more out there, but that's all for now by me
